***Sold by Caelia Collins of Riverfront Real Estate on 08/09/2022 for $1,075,000*** Discover story-book enchantment and a world of tranquillity within a 925m2 allotment with this traditional cottage-style home. Immersed in established gardens that act as a natural canopy of serenity and seclusion, this two-storey home is endearing in every way. Enriched with stunning cathedral ceilings, charming timber panelling and flooring and a soothing colour palette, it embraces you with warmth and comfort, evoking a sense of instant belonging. Enjoy the versatile floorplan with two separate living zones, complemented by a well-equipped kitchen and plenty of connection to the outdoors. Large windows and doors frame views of the lushly planted rainforest garden, with multiple alfresco verandahs to tempt you to stop and sit awhile in this blissful botanic oasis. Meander through the magical gardens to the mangroves, which give way to the water's edge. The character continues with the bathroom with a traditional clawfoot tub to soak away the day as well as three bedrooms and study, crowned by beautiful, timber-clad cathedral ceilings. It's also just a 650m walk to the Mooney Mooney Public Wharf and Deerubbun Reserve, where you can easily explore the Hawkesbury River waterways. All the amenities of Brooklyn await in 6km, including the Hawkesbury River Train Station, with the Sydney CBD less than an hour by car.
